Hepatoprotective Agents in Liver Disease Management
Hepatoprotective agents play a crucial role in the treatment of liver disease. These substances aim to reduce liver injury and support its ability to heal.
Numerous classes of hepatoprotective agents exist, each with specific mechanisms of action. Some substances act through decreasing swelling, while others focus on protect liver cells from harm. The choice of hepatoprotective agent is contingent upon the particular type and degree of liver disease.
Furthermore, ongoing research is continually discovering new and innovative hepatoprotective agents with optimized efficacy and safety profiles.

Novel Therapeutic Methodologies for Hepatobiliary Malignancy
Hepatobiliary malignancies pose a significant global health challenge due to their aggressive nature and limited treatment options. Current research has focused on developing novel therapeutic strategies to improve patient outcomes.
One promising avenue is the utilization of rational therapies that specifically inhibit key molecular pathways involved in tumor progression. Another beneficial approach involves the use of immunotherapy, which harnesses the power of the patient's own immune system to destroy cancer cells.
Furthermore, advancements in gene editing technologies offer potential for long-lasting treatment strategies by correcting or disrupting the genetic abnormalities that drive tumor formation. Clinical trials are currently underway to evaluate the efficacy and safety of these novel therapeutic approaches in hepatobiliary cancer patients.

Understanding the Complexities of Hepatobiliary Disease
Hepatobiliary disease encompasses a variety of conditions affecting the liver and its associated channels. These structures play a vital role in digestion nutrients, removing waste products, and producing bile. Recognizing hepatobiliary disease can be challenging due to the delicate nature of its manifestations.
Typically, symptoms may be unnoticeable in the initial stages, leading to prolonged diagnosis and possible complications. A comprehensive medical history, physical examination, and a series of evaluative tests, including blood work, imaging studies, and biopsies, are crucial for reliable diagnosis and formulation of an suitable treatment plan.
Management for hepatobiliary disease varies depending on the underlying cause and intensity of the condition. Options may include medications, lifestyle modifications, operative interventions, or a combination thereof.
